Output 3ce921319282856630421c0ca667a2e9eb3ff5910c50b67f624eb755b57c1c36:20

value
3533655
script pubkey
OP_0 OP_PUSHBYTES_20 f6a58dcdd408961e4b6d75c5b9d25c82e0cff0da
address
bc1q76jcmnw5pztpujmdwhzmn5justsvlux64ufd32
transaction
3ce921319282856630421c0ca667a2e9eb3ff5910c50b67f624eb755b57c1c36